GENERAL INFORMATION ABOUT
UNEMPLOYMENT INSURANCE TAX
The Colorado Unemployment
Insurance (UI) Program is responsible for administering the following key
tax-related functions:
Determine employer liability and establish UI tax
accounts.
Collect UI taxes through a quarterly employer
tax-and-wage-reporting process.
Notify employers of annual tax rates.
Conduct field audits of employer records to ensure:
Wages are accurately
reported.
The correct amount of UI
taxes is paid.
Employers comply with UI
laws and regulations.
Collect overdue UI taxes as well as penalties and
interest.
Provide for fair and impartial hearings before a
hearing officer when liability decisions are appealed.
